Grout removal services involve the careful process of extracting old, damaged, or deteriorated grout from between tiles. This task typically requires specialized tools and techniques to ensure the surrounding tiles remain intact and undamaged. Once the old grout is removed, it creates a clean slate for regrouting or replacing with fresh grout, which can improve both the appearance and functionality of tiled surfaces. Professional grout removal helps ensure the job is done efficiently and thoroughly, reducing the risk of damage and preparing the area for further updates or repairs.
This service is especially helpful in resolving common problems associated with aging or compromised grout. Over time, grout can crack, stain, or crumble, allowing moisture and dirt to seep beneath tiles. This can lead to mold growth, water damage, or unsightly discoloration. Grout removal allows for the removal of these issues at their source, making way for new grout that can restore the surface’s integrity and appearance. It is also a key step in tile renovation projects, helping to refresh kitchens, bathrooms, or other tiled areas that have seen years of wear and tear.

The overview below groups typical Grout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or grout removal projects,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. These jobs often involve small areas or straightforward tile work, making them more affordable.
Mid-Range Projects - Larger, more involved grout removal jobs usually fall within the $600-$1,500 range. Many routine jobs land in this band, which covers most residential bathroom and kitchen repairs.
Extensive Renovations - For extensive tile and grout replacement, costs can range from $1,500 to $3,000. These projects often include multiple rooms or larger surfaces requiring more labor and materials.
Larger, Complex Jobs - Very large or complex grout removal projects, such as whole-home overhauls, can reach $5,000 or more. Fewer projects push into this highest tier, which typically involves significant demolition and reconstruction work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
